O que é: Fator de Velocidade de Carregamento de Páginas

O que é: Fator de Velocidade de Carregamento de Páginas

O fator de velocidade de carregamento de páginas é um dos principais aspectos considerados pelos motores de busca, como o Google, na hora de classificar e posicionar um site nos resultados de pesquisa. Ele se refere ao tempo que uma página leva para carregar completamente no navegador do usuário, incluindo todos os elementos visuais, como imagens, vídeos e scripts, além do conteúdo textual.

Importância do Fator de Velocidade de Carregamento de Páginas

A velocidade de carregamento de páginas é um fator crucial para a experiência do usuário. Estudos mostram que a maioria dos usuários espera que uma página carregue em no máximo 2 segundos. Se uma página demora mais do que isso para carregar, é provável que o usuário abandone o site e procure por outra fonte de informação. Além disso, a velocidade de carregamento também afeta a taxa de conversão, já que usuários tendem a realizar menos compras em sites lentos.

Como medir o Fator de Velocidade de Carregamento de Páginas

Existem diversas ferramentas disponíveis para medir o fator de velocidade de carregamento de páginas. Uma das mais populares é o PageSpeed Insights, do Google, que fornece uma pontuação de 0 a 100 para a velocidade de carregamento de uma página, além de sugestões de melhorias. Outras ferramentas incluem o GTmetrix e o Pingdom, que também oferecem análises detalhadas sobre o desempenho de um site.

Fatores que influenciam o Fator de Velocidade de Carregamento de Páginas

O fator de velocidade de carregamento de páginas é influenciado por diversos fatores, tanto técnicos quanto de conteúdo. Alguns dos principais fatores incluem:

1. Tamanho dos arquivos

O tamanho dos arquivos, como imagens e vídeos, que compõem uma página pode afetar significativamente o tempo de carregamento. Arquivos grandes demoram mais para serem baixados pelo navegador, o que pode resultar em uma experiência lenta para o usuário. É importante otimizar os arquivos, reduzindo seu tamanho sem comprometer a qualidade.

2. Hospedagem do site

A qualidade e a velocidade do servidor onde o site está hospedado também podem influenciar no tempo de carregamento. Servidores lentos ou sobrecarregados podem causar atrasos no carregamento das páginas. É recomendado escolher uma hospedagem confiável e de alta performance.

3. Código do site

O código do site, incluindo HTML, CSS e JavaScript, também pode afetar o tempo de carregamento. Códigos mal otimizados ou desnecessários podem aumentar o tamanho dos arquivos e tornar o carregamento mais lento. É importante seguir boas práticas de desenvolvimento web e minimizar o uso de scripts desnecessários.

4. Cache do navegador

O cache do navegador permite que elementos de uma página sejam armazenados temporariamente no computador do usuário, reduzindo o tempo de carregamento em visitas futuras. É importante configurar corretamente o cache do navegador para aproveitar esse recurso e melhorar a velocidade de carregamento.

5. Conexão de internet

A velocidade da conexão de internet do usuário também pode influenciar no tempo de carregamento de uma página. Conexões mais lentas demoram mais para baixar os arquivos necessários, resultando em uma experiência mais lenta para o usuário. É importante considerar a velocidade média da conexão dos usuários e otimizar o site de acordo.

Como otimizar o Fator de Velocidade de Carregamento de Páginas

Existem diversas estratégias e técnicas que podem ser utilizadas para otimizar o fator de velocidade de carregamento de páginas. Alguns exemplos incluem:

1. Compressão de arquivos

A compressão de arquivos, como imagens e scripts, pode reduzir significativamente o tamanho dos arquivos, sem comprometer a qualidade. Isso resulta em um tempo de carregamento mais rápido. Existem diversas ferramentas disponíveis para comprimir arquivos, como o TinyPNG para imagens e o UglifyJS para scripts.

2. Minificação de código

A minificação de código consiste em remover espaços em branco, comentários e outros caracteres desnecessários do código do site, reduzindo seu tamanho. Isso resulta em um tempo de carregamento mais rápido. Existem diversas ferramentas disponíveis para minificar código, como o CSSNano para CSS e o UglifyJS para JavaScript.

3. Utilização de CDN

Uma CDN (Content Delivery Network) é uma rede de servidores distribuídos globalmente que armazena cópias de arquivos estáticos, como imagens e scripts, e os entrega aos usuários a partir do servidor mais próximo geograficamente. Isso reduz a latência e melhora o tempo de carregamento. Existem diversas opções de CDNs disponíveis, como o Cloudflare e o Amazon CloudFront.

4. Otimização de cache

Configurar corretamente o cache do navegador e utilizar cabeçalhos de cache apropriados pode melhorar significativamente o tempo de carregamento de uma página. Isso permite que elementos estáticos sejam armazenados no cache do navegador e reutilizados em visitas futuras. É importante definir uma política de cache adequada e utilizar cabeçalhos de cache corretamente.

5. Priorização de carregamento

Priorizar o carregamento de elementos críticos, como conteúdo textual e botões de chamada para ação, pode melhorar a percepção de velocidade do usuário. Isso pode ser feito utilizando técnicas como carregamento assíncrono de scripts e carregamento progressivo de imagens. É importante identificar os elementos mais importantes da página e garantir que sejam carregados rapidamente.

Conclusão

A velocidade de carregamento de páginas é um fator essencial para o sucesso de um site. Um carregamento rápido proporciona uma melhor experiência para o usuário, aumenta a taxa de conversão e melhora o posicionamento nos motores de busca. Ao otimizar o fator de velocidade de carregamento de páginas, é possível obter melhores resultados e alcançar o máximo potencial do site.

Sobre o autor | Website